웹팩

최신 웹 애플리케이션을 위한 번들

Addy Osmani
Addy Osmani

최신 웹 애플리케이션에서는 번들 도구를 사용하여 최적화되고 축소되며 사용자가 더 빠르게 다운로드할 수 있는 파일 (스크립트, 스타일시트 등)의 프로덕션 '번들'을 만드는 경우가 많습니다. webpack을 사용한 웹 성능 최적화에서는 webpack을 사용하여 사이트 리소스를 효과적으로 최적화하는 방법을 알아봅니다. 이렇게 하면 사용자가 더 빠르게 사이트를 로드하고 상호작용할 수 있습니다.

Webpack 로고

webpack은 오늘날 가장 많이 사용되는 번들 도구 중 하나입니다. 최신 코드를 최적화하는 기능을 활용하여 중요한 부분과 중요하지 않은 부분으로 스크립트를 코드 분할하고 사용되지 않는 코드를 제거 (몇 가지 최적화만 포함)하면 앱의 네트워크와 처리 비용을 최소화할 수 있습니다.

자바스크립트 최적화 적용 전후 상호작용까지의 시간이 개선됨  

Susie Lu의 Bundle Buddy의 코드 분할에서 영감을 얻었습니다.

먼저 최신 앱에서 비용이 가장 많이 드는 리소스 중 하나인 JavaScript를 최적화하는 방법을 살펴보겠습니다.